Most incidents trace to the weather-feed parser choking on malformed forecasts. Restart the worker, then replay the night's batch — order matters. Code reviews for the scheduler require two approvals because past hotfixes broke the cron offsets. Don't merge anything touching timezone math without running the fixture suite. Alert thresholds, replay commands, and the review checklist are all documented on the internal page here.

runbook for tafof-yawif: https://confluence.tolvaqsys.internal/display/display/browse/pages/7be3

# Approvals: Cold-start tuning on Glimmerfn

Hey! Quick rules before you touch cold-start settings on our serverless handlers. Any change to provisioned concurrency, memory sizing, or warmer schedules needs an approval ticket — yes, even "tiny" ones, since costs on the Pell cluster spike fast. Post benchmarks from the staging probe, then request sign-off. The approver for all cold-start changes is named below.

account owner for tawef-yadug: Jorius Normir Silath

**Ticket: Expired credentials blocking bulk edits in Ordermint admin**

Since Tuesday, bulk edits in the Ordermint admin table fail with a 401. Root cause: the service credential used by the bulk-edit worker expired and the auto-renewal job was disabled during the Fernhollow migration. Single-row edits still work because they use session auth. A fresh credential has been issued with the same scopes (rows:write, audit:append). New team members picking this up: update the worker config and redeploy. The replacement key is below.

app token of yajeg-kawef = kto11_7En3XSX8xQw

## Authentication

Gridsmith, our crossword generator, delegates auth to the internal Lexvault service. Every grid-fill request must carry a bearer token; anonymous calls are rejected with a 401 and logged. For the weekly eng sync demo, use the shared staging credential rather than personal tokens. The staging credential for Lexvault appears directly below.

gateway credential: kto3_qfe